Maximizing Uptime: Strategies for Minimizing Downtime in Fleet Operations

In fleet management, maximizing vehicle uptime is crucial for maintaining efficiency, meeting delivery schedules, and optimizing costs. Downtime, whether due to scheduled maintenance or unexpected breakdowns, can significantly disrupt operations and lead to financial losses. Implementing effective strategies to minimize downtime is essential for keeping your fleet running smoothly. Here are some key strategies to help you achieve this goal.

Implement Predictive Maintenance

Predictive maintenance involves using data analytics and telematics to anticipate and address maintenance needs before they lead to breakdowns. By continuously monitoring vehicle performance through sensors and telematics systems, you can predict potential failures and perform maintenance proactively. This approach reduces the likelihood of unexpected breakdowns and extends the lifespan of your vehicles.

  • Benefits: Reduced unplanned downtime, lower maintenance costs, improved vehicle reliability.
  • Tools: Telematics systems, IoT sensors, data analytics platforms.

Regular Preventive Maintenance

While predictive maintenance focuses on anticipating issues, preventive maintenance involves regular, scheduled servicing of vehicles to keep them in optimal condition. This includes routine checks and replacements such as oil changes, tire rotations, and brake inspections.

  • Benefits: Early detection of wear and tear, consistent vehicle performance, compliance with safety standards.
  • Tools: Maintenance scheduling software, checklists, maintenance logs.

Utilize Fleet Management Software

Fleet management software helps automate and streamline various aspects of fleet operations, including maintenance scheduling, tracking service history, and monitoring vehicle health. This software provides real-time insights and alerts, ensuring that maintenance tasks are performed on time and that potential issues are addressed promptly.

  • Benefits: Centralized data management, automated alerts, comprehensive reporting.
  • Tools: Stand-alone fleet management programs, or proprietary software from Fleet Management companies that can integrate all data for a holistic overview of your fleet’s health and maintenance needs.

Train and Educate Drivers

Drivers are on the front line of your fleet operations and play a critical role in vehicle maintenance. Providing training on best driving practices and basic vehicle checks can help prevent avoidable issues.

  • Training Topics: Recognizing early warning signs of vehicle problems, performing basic maintenance checks, reporting issues promptly.
  • Benefits: Reduced wear and tear, quicker issue detection, improved driver safety.

Optimize Routes and Schedules

Efficient route planning reduces unnecessary mileage and wear on vehicles. By using route optimization tools, you can ensure that your vehicles are operating under optimal conditions, reducing the likelihood of breakdowns due to overuse or challenging driving conditions.

  • Benefits: Reduced fuel consumption, lower vehicle wear, improved delivery times.
  • Tools: GPS tracking, route optimization software, telematics systems.

Maintain a Spare Vehicle Pool

Having a pool of spare vehicles can help you manage downtime more effectively. When a vehicle is out of service for maintenance or repairs, a spare vehicle can take its place, ensuring that operations continue without interruption.

  • Benefits: Continuous operations, reduced impact of downtime, flexibility in fleet management.
  • Considerations: Cost of maintaining spare vehicles, space for storage, insurance.

Establish Strong Relationships with Service Providers

Partnering with reliable maintenance and repair service providers ensures that your vehicles receive timely and quality service. Establishing strong relationships with these providers can lead to priority service and potentially lower costs.

  • Benefits: Faster turnaround times, trusted service quality, potential cost savings.
  • Tips: Negotiate service agreements, regularly review provider performance, maintain open communication.

Monitor and Analyze Performance Data

Regularly analyzing performance data helps identify trends and potential issues before they become serious problems. Monitoring key metrics such as fuel efficiency, breakdown frequency, and maintenance costs provides valuable insights for improving fleet operations.

  • Benefits: Informed decision-making, early issue detection, continuous improvement.
  • Tools: Data analytics platforms, performance dashboards, telematics reports.
